In the palace of Oberonia, a ritual was in full swing to resurrect ‘Enceladus,’ a demon god who had consumed the inhabitants of the Oberon Kingdom as sacrifices.
This ritual, ignited by Aegir’s death and fueled by the blood and vitality of living people, was approaching its final stages.
The purpose of this ritual was to break down the barrier between the place where the demon god was sealed and reality.
If the barrier between that place and reality collapsed, the demon god would absorb the souls possessed by the citizens of the Oberon Kingdom.
Through this, though not completely, he would gain a physical form that could manifest in the material world.
“No being in this world will be able to harm him.”
Belinda realized that the resurrection of the demon god was imminent.
All that remained was to wait without interference until the entire ritual was completed.
But just as the ritual seemed to be progressing smoothly, an ominous feeling flashed through Belinda’s mind.
Leaving the ritual site briefly, she noticed that the discordant energy surrounding the Oberon Kingdom had become harmonious.
This could only mean one thing.
“Could it be that the barrier has broken?”
The barrier created through Aegir’s sacrifice had been shattered.
The barrier, made through the sacrifice of Aegir, who could be called a great demon, was so strong that it could withstand attacks from the strongest beings in this world for days.
This barrier, which deflected attacks and sent them into the ‘void,’ was the culmination of lifelong research by Aegir and Belinda for the ritual to resurrect the demon god.
She had been confident that the demon god’s resurrection would succeed as soon as the barrier was formed.
With only one day left until the completion of the ritual, which had begun after sacrificing all life except for the 1,000 suicide squad members protecting the ritual site.
Just one more day, and the complete resurrection of the demon god would be achieved!
One day!
Just one more day was all they needed!
“Leon!”
“Yes, Lady Belinda!”
“Take the suicide squad and hold them back! Buy as much time as possible! I will complete the ritual by any means necessary.”
“Yes, I will give my life for His resurrection. Death for Him is our duty.”
Leon led 900 of the suicide squad members, leaving 100 for Belinda, and headed toward the entrance of Oberonia.
Oberonia, the capital of the Oberon Kingdom, was a place that could never be penetrated as long as the single entrance from the Windgrass Gorge was guarded.
As Leon and the 900 suicide squad members stood on the wall, they could see thousands of holy alliance forces composed of priests and holy knights rushing toward them in the distance.
“Truly impressive.”
Leon admired the holy alliance forces approaching.
This was not sarcasm, but genuine admiration for their numbers.
“But today, they will perish here. Even if we die, we just need to buy enough time. This place is perfect for that.”
The suicide squad that followed Leon believed they could buy enough time here.
The reason was simple: this was a fortress wall.
“If we lock the gates and force them into a siege, they have no siege weapons, so it will take them at least three days to break through. By then, the ritual will be complete.”
They thought the holy alliance forces, without proper siege equipment, would be unable to breach if they locked the gates and held out.
And this was true.
“They’ve locked the gates.”
“It’s too late to bring siege equipment! Can’t we just break through?”
“Many will be sacrificed. If we must, we have no choice but to charge.”
Without proper siege equipment, their only means of breaching the wall was to climb over it and open the gates from inside.
But since this was everyone’s first time in such a battle, they didn’t know what to do.
A simple charge would inevitably result in casualties from Leon’s suicide squad’s attacks.
Moreover, Eterna needed to conserve her strength for emergencies, so the priests and holy knights couldn’t think of a proper breakthrough method.
“What are you all worrying about?”
At that moment, the Heavenly Demon appeared.
“Ah, the hero who helped the Saint defeat the demon. We’re facing evil forces barricaded behind those gates.”
“Evil forces? Ah, you mean those fellows admiring us from atop the wall?”
“Yes.”
Hearing the priest’s words, Cheon Hyeryeong looked at the wall and gauged the distance between them.
“This distance should be manageable.”
“What do you mean?”
“I mean prepare to breach the wall and rush to where the ritual is taking place.”
Pathos translated Cheon Hyeryeong’s seemingly absurd statement for everyone.
“What does that mean?”
“Exactly what I said. She’s going to blow away the wall, and then we should hurry to where the ritual is taking place.”
The priests and holy knights questioned whether this was even possible.
“Where I come from, there’s a saying: ‘Seeing once is better than hearing a hundred times.’ It means that seeing something once is better than hearing about it a hundred times.”
Cheon Hyeryeong carefully walked forward to ensure people wouldn’t be caught in the aftermath.
After confirming that the people who came with Pathos were standing behind her, she took her stance and raised her fist to the sky.
“Listen! I am the greatest under heaven, unmatched throughout history! I am the leader of the Heavenly Demon Sect, the Heavenly Demon!”
As she raised her fist to the sky, heat haze began to rise, and the sky suddenly darkened.
Unlike the clouds wrapping around the distant pillar of light, her clouds resembled those of the night sky.
“If there is another heaven above the sky, it would be me!”
She then stepped forward with her left foot, pressing firmly on the ground, pulled back her right shoulder, and took a punching stance.
“My fist shatters the heavens and places them beneath my feet!”
With her final cry, her right fist thrust forward, and an overwhelming, domineering energy poured from her fist.
This was the martial art she had used to defeat Eldran.
The True Heavenly Demon God Fist.
The domineering force of the True Heavenly Demon God Fist emanating from Cheon Hyeryeong’s hand began to sweep away everything in its path.
It was more like a natural disaster than a martial art performed by a human.
The force of the True Heavenly Demon God Fist soon reached the gates guarded by Leon and the 900 suicide squad members, and its domineering energy rotated, tearing apart the gates and the 900 suicide squad members standing on the wall.
Its power was so intense that the solid granite walls turned into fine stone powder.
If even the solid walls turned to dust, what of Leon and the 900 suicide squad members?
Leon and the 900 suicide squad members, who had been prepared for a last stand on the wall, met a painless death without being able to do anything.
Not a single blade of grass remained where the True Heavenly Demon God Fist had swept through.
Before the priests and holy knights lay a wide-open path straight to the palace of Oberonia.
The holy knights who trained in martial arts trembled at the sight.
Anyone who revered martial prowess would tremble before her overwhelming might.
The priests were grateful that they could enter the Oberon Kingdom without any casualties.
To them, the demon cult’s suicide squad weren’t considered human.
The fact that they had survived the horrific scenes where people’s vitality was drained meant they were in league with those conducting the evil ritual.
“Impossible…”
And Belinda, who had witnessed Oberonia’s walls being blown away, was shocked.
Even Aegir, who had been powerful among demons, couldn’t have done something like this.
This meant that the being who had killed Aegir was among them.
Belinda rushed to where the ritual was taking place.
At this rate, the 100 suicide squad members would soon be “former” suicide squad members.
Belinda realized it was time to use her last resort.
“I had hoped to avoid using this method…”
This was to sacrifice herself to accelerate the demon god’s resurrection.
Though not as powerful as Aegir, she was also one of the great demons.
If she sacrificed everything she had, all the conditions necessary for the demon god’s resurrection would be met.
However, if the demon god were to be resurrected this way, it would be an incomplete resurrection.
If the demon god were to fall here, there would be a risk of complete annihilation.
But as the ritual was about to fail completely, Belinda leaped into the pillar of light, prepared to die.
After she jumped into the pillar of light, the beam shooting toward the sky suddenly thickened, stirring the heavens, and the barrier of reality collapsed.
[Finally, finally, I am resurrected!]
And so the demon god Enceladus, though incompletely, descended upon this world.
